In depth
Verdict
Deadly Move never looked like winning when favourite at Uttoxeter last month and finished behind Wade Harper – he is now 0-14 under Rules. The step up in trip is a worry for novice Bold Duke but Court Dismissed has turned a corner and defied market expectations when following up a Fakenham win at Worcester. Don Franco beat Shaiyzar at Perth in May and, like Mister Don, is a strong stayer, though a little one-paced. JACK SNIPE has gone up 17lb after back-to-back wins at Worcester and Newton Abbot but is starting to look a useful addition to the chasing ranks and is almost certainly still improving whereas Dursey Sound appears to be moving in the opposite direction.
